Source Unknown; Date Unknown November 22, 1979-February 28, 2003 Laura Carynne Reeves, 23, died February 28, 2003 in Dallas, Texas, after a long and courageous battle with a serious illness. Laura was a 1997 graduate of Tehachapi High School, who worked as a customer service representative for United Airlines. Laura enjoyed music and travel. Her favorite places to visit were Lake Tahoe and Hawaii. She touched many people so deeply that several friends and co-workers will be traveling long distances to attend her services in Mojave. Laura had a special relationship with her family, especially her grandfathers. She called her grandfather Reeves "Paw" and allowed her grandfather Risner to call her Lula Belle. A celebration of her life will be held on March 15 at the Mojave Assembly of God Church, 1607 M. St. at 2 p.m. Rev. Grant Frye will officiate the service. Laura is survived by her mother, Valerie Reeves of Templeton; father Dwaine Reeves of California; sister, Dana Reeves of Bakersfield; nephew Nathan Cole Reeves; fiancée, Andy Van Tassel of Fort Worth, Texas; grandparents, Kendall and Vern Risner of Mojave and Opal Reeves of Bakersfield; a great-grandmother, Vergie Risner of Lamont a large extended family and a host of friends.
